Join FotoFest Associate Curator Max Fields for a tour of the exhibition In Place of an Index, produced and presented in conjunction with the 2021 Texas Biennial exhibition, A New Landscape, A Possible Horizon. The exhibition features artists native to or living and working in Texas, including Regina Agu, Travis Boyer, Tay Butler, Ja’Tovia Gary, Ryan Hawk, Autumn Knight, Baseera Khan, Annette Lawrence, Adam Marnie and Aura Rosenberg, Stephanie Concepcion Ramirez, and Kara Springer.

About Max Fields

Max Fields is the Associate Curator and Director of Publishing at FotoFest. He has presented numerous exhibitions and has written for and overseen the production of multiple museum and gallery publications. Fields’s exhibitions and projects have been reviewed in publications including Frieze, ArtForum, Art in America, and Aperture among others. Recent projects include Public Life (2020–21), African Cosmologies: Photography, Time, and the Other (with Mark Sealy, 2020), and Gareth Long: Kidnappers Foil at the Blaffer Art Museum (2019-20). His current exhibition, In Place of an Index, is produced and presented with the 2021 Texas Biennial and is co-curated with Ryan Dennis and Evan Garza. His upcoming exhibition includes the 2022 FotoFest Biennial, co-curated with Steven Evans and Amy Sadao.
